Uneven Playing Field
The civil rights division of the U.S. Education Department is investigating a complaint that some high schools in Rockingham County, N.C., favor male baseball athletes at the expense of girls softball teams. Superintendent Rodney Shotwell says he knows outdoor facilities for the teams at the four high schools are not equal, and changes are needed.
